/  All사 아스웹 사이트 개발  / 10년 상위 2022개 이상의 소프트웨어 개발 동향

10년 상위 2022개 이상의 소프트웨어 개발 동향

빌 게이츠는 소프트웨어가 예술성과 엔지니어링의 훌륭한 결합이라고 말한 적이 있습니다.

소프트웨어 개발 트렌드는 다가올 시대를 정복하거나 지배하려는 최고의 소프트웨어 개발 기술로 정의할 수 있습니다.

여기에는 자동화된 코드 검토, 소프트웨어 프로젝트 아웃소싱, 코딩 표준에 중점을 두는 것 등이 포함됩니다. AI 기반 접근 방식 올해 주목해야 할 트렌드는 다음과 같습니다.

현재 비즈니스 시장의 상황은 매우 어렵습니다. 이는 코비드 대유행으로 인한 문제 때문이다. 모든 기업은 엄청난 도전에 직면하고 있으며 기술을 통해 시장 위치를 ​​유지하고 지속적으로 수익을 창출할 수 있습니다.

귀하의 비즈니스도 동일한 문제에 직면하고 있습니까? 

귀하의 비즈니스 문제를 극복하기 위해 기술 동향에 대한 솔루션을 찾기 위해 노력하고 있습니까? 

당신은 SaaS 전략 최신 시장 동향에 영향을 받나요?

기업은 이미 소프트웨어 개발 및 기술과 관련된 훌륭한 아이디어의 도움으로 성장을 촉진하고 있습니다. 따라서 글로벌 소프트웨어 시장 규모는 1493.07년까지 2025억 XNUMX천만 달러 달성 연평균 성장률(CAGR)은 11%입니다.

더욱이, 소프트웨어 개발 동향은 지속적으로 변화하며 그 중 일부는 2022년 사업 연도를 지배할 것으로 예상됩니다. 기업이 성장하고 확장하려면 시장에 대한 최신 정보를 얻고 소프트웨어 개발 세계에서 일어나는 변화를 따라잡아야 합니다. 

이 기사는 소프트웨어 개발 동향에 대해 논의하는 것을 목표로 합니다. 소프트웨어 세계를 정복할 것이다. 따라서 주요 트렌드를 놓치지 않고 10년 상위 2022가지 소프트웨어 개발 트렌드를 살펴보겠습니다.

1. 웹 3.0의 부상:

웹 3.0은 월드 와이드 웹(World Wide Web)의 세 번째 중요한 버전입니다. 여기에는 분산형 애플리케이션, 스마트 계약 및 P3.0P 네트워킹이 포함됩니다. 기업은 소프트웨어 개발 아웃소싱을 사용하여 최고의 제품을 고객에게 제공합니다. 웹 XNUMX은 시장에 출시된 정교함과 상호작용성이라는 특징을 가지고 있습니다. 이전 버전과 달리 단순하고 정적인 페이지의 기준을 넘어섰습니다.

지금까지 Web 3.0의 경험은 데스크톱 브라우저나 OLED 화면이 탑재된 스마트폰과 같은 고급형 모바일 장치에서만 제한되었습니다. 하지만 곧 모든 기기와 호환될 예정입니다.

웹 3.0의 몇 가지 이점은 다음과 같습니다.

  • 이는 사용자에게 더욱 세련되고 상호 작용적인 경험을 제공합니다.
  • 보다 동적이고 반응성이 뛰어난 디자인을 위해 Web 3.0 애플리케이션은 JavaScript를 사용하여 구축되었습니다.
  • 더 빠르게 로드하기 위해 최신 컴퓨터 하드웨어를 사용합니다.

2. NEFT(국가 전자 자금 이체) 토큰:

NEFT는 은행 계좌 간 자금 이체 방식입니다. NEFT 토큰은 새로운 것입니다 암호화폐의 종류 빠르고 안전한 거래 제공에 중점을 두고 있습니다. NEFT 토큰은 블록체인 기반 결제 분야에서 더욱 영향력 있는 추세의 일부로 간주됩니다. 

2022년에는 이러한 NEFT 토큰이 SDO(소프트웨어 개발 아웃소싱)에서 가장 표준적인 지불 방식이 될 것입니다.

NEFT 토큰은 NEFF에 의해 구동됩니다 blockchain. 이는 기업과 관련된 모든 이해관계자 사이에 안전하고 투명하며 빠른 지불 프로세스를 제공합니다.

NEFT 토큰의 일부 이점은 다음과 같습니다.

3. 자동화된 코드 검토 증가:

인간 검토자는 요즘 만들어지는 코드의 양 때문에 따라잡기가 매우 어렵다는 것을 알게 됩니다. 이러한 자동화된 코드 검토 도구는 오류와 잠재적인 문제를 즉시 식별하여 이러한 문제를 해결하는 데 도움이 됩니다. 조직 전체에서 코딩 표준을 유지하는 것도 훨씬 쉬워졌습니다.

이는 자동 검토가 완벽하다는 것을 보장하지는 않지만 수동 검토보다 약간 더 정확합니다. 따라서 귀하의 소프트웨어 제품이 시장에서 최고가 되기를 원한다면 자동화된 리뷰를 사용하는 이러한 추세를 따라가십시오.

자동화된 코드 검토의 이점은 다음과 같습니다.

  • 오류와 가능한 문제를 더 빠르게 식별합니다.
  • 코딩에 대한 표준을 쉽게 유지할 수 있습니다.
  • 자동 검토는 수동 검토보다 더 확실합니다.

4) 아웃소싱에 대한 수요 증가:

여러 기업에서는 소프트웨어 개발 산업의 변화하는 요구 사항을 따라잡을 수 있는 리소스가 필요합니다. 아웃소싱이 시작되는 곳입니다.

팀을 아웃소싱함으로써 기업은 코딩, 테스트, 심지어는 다양한 서비스를 받을 수 있습니다. 제품 관리. 아웃소싱을 통해 다양한 프로그래밍 언어에 능숙한 유능한 개발자를 확보할 수 있습니다. 

이러한 이점과 이미 갖고 있는 인기를 고려하면 아웃소싱은 향후 몇 년 동안 더욱 성장할 가능성이 높습니다.

아웃소싱을 통해 얻을 수 있는 몇 가지 이점은 다음과 같습니다.

  • 이제 더 많은 리소스를 사용할 수 있습니다.
  • 아웃소싱은 다양한 서비스를 제공합니다.

5. 쿠버네티스의 부상:

Kubernetes 컨테이너화된 애플리케이션을 관리하는 데 사용되는 플랫폼입니다.

컨테이너화는 이제 소프트웨어를 제공하는 인기 있는 방법이 되고 있습니다. 사내에서든 아웃소싱하든 컨테이너는 소프트웨어 개발 팀에서 패키징하고 배포하는 데 사용됩니다.

Kubernetes는 선도적인 플랫폼 중 하나이며 배포 프로세스의 많은 요소를 자동화하는 데 도움을 주었습니다. 이로 인해 개발자는 서버를 구성하는 대신 새로운 기능을 만들 수 있습니다.

Kubernetes의 이점은 다음과 같습니다.

  • 배포 프로세스의 여러 측면을 자동화합니다.
  • 컨테이너화된 애플리케이션을 매우 빠르게 관리하기 위한 선도적인 플랫폼이 되고 있습니다.
  • 다양한 프로그래밍 언어에 활용될 수 있습니다.

6. 클라우드 네이티브 기술이 지배할 것:

올해 안에, 더 많은 초점이 주어질 것입니다. 소프트웨어 개발 회사 클라우드 네이티브 기술에 대해 알아보세요. 클라우드 네이티브는 분산된 퍼블릭, 프라이빗 및 하이브리드 클라우드 내에서 실행되도록 개발된 소프트웨어 아키텍처입니다. 여러 서버를 효율적으로 운영하려면 회사에서 제공하는 소프트웨어 제품에 이 설계가 필요합니다.

클라우드 네이티브 소프트웨어 아키텍처에는 다음과 같은 이점이 있습니다.

  • 수많은 서버로 작업하는 동안 효율성과 확장성이 향상됩니다.
  • 소프트웨어 제품은 퍼블릭, 프라이빗 또는 하이브리드 클라우드에서 실행될 수 있습니다.

7. AI 및 ML 기반 접근 방식의 추가 사용:

2022년 소프트웨어 개발 트렌드를 이야기하면 AI와 ML은 간과할 수 없는 부분입니다. 소프트웨어 개발 아웃소싱은 AI 및 ML 기반 접근 방식에 따라 결정됩니다. 

인공 지능(AI) 접근 방식에는 명시적으로 프로그래밍하지 않고도 데이터를 이해하고 예측이나 조치를 취하도록 설계된 소프트웨어가 포함됩니다.

인공지능(AI)에 대한 더욱 주목할만한 추세는 ML 또는 머신러닝입니다. ML을 사용하면 더욱 강력한 예측 분석과 자동화된 의사 결정이 가능합니다. 소프트웨어 제품의 효율성과 효과를 높이려면 이 기술이 필요합니다.

소프트웨어 제품이 AI 또는 ML 기술로 구동되면 더 효율적이고 효과적으로 작동합니다.

8. 예측 분석의 더 많은 활용: 

예측 분석은 많은 SaaS 회사, 마케팅 담당자 및 디지털 대행사에서 알려지지 않은 미래 사건을 예측하는 데 사용됩니다. 이러한 예측은 데이터 마이닝, 통계, 모델링, 기계 학습(ML) 및 인공 지능(AI)의 여러 기술을 분석한 후 이루어집니다. 예측 분석은 소프트웨어 개발의 필수적인 부분이 되고 있습니다.

예측 분석은 다음 용도로 사용될 수 있습니다.

  • 제품에 어떤 기능을 추가할지 결정합니다.
  • 가능한 구매자를 식별합니다.
  • 시장에서 소프트웨어 제품의 성능을 예측합니다.
  • 결정을 내리고 고객의 요구를 충족시킵니다.

예측 분석의 몇 가지 이점은 다음과 같습니다.

  • 보다 효율적인 소프트웨어 제품.
  • 더 나은 비즈니스 의사결정.

9) 파이썬:

Python 웹 사이트 및 소프트웨어 제작, 작업 자동화 및 데이터 분석에 활용할 수 있는 범용 컴퓨터 프로그래밍 언어입니다. Python은 단지 몇 가지에만 특화된 것이 아닙니다. 실제로 다양한 프로그램을 혼합하여 만드는 데 사용할 수 있습니다. 

스크립팅, 프로토타이핑, 데이터 분석, 기계 학습 및 더 많은 작업에 사용할 수 있습니다. 소프트웨어 개발자들 사이에서 Python의 인기가 높아지고 있는 이유는 배우기 쉬운 품질과 이미 수년에 걸쳐 축적된 대규모 사용자 기반 때문입니다. 

소프트웨어 개발 회사는 생산성을 높이고 최상의 결과를 얻기 위해 Python을 더 많이 사용하는 것을 선호할 것입니다.

Python을 사용하면 다음과 같은 이점이 있습니다.

  • Python은 대규모 사용자 기반을 갖춘 언어로 구축하여 비용을 절감합니다.
  • 소프트웨어 제품은 Python 코드를 사용하여 구축하면 설계하기가 더 쉬울 수 있습니다.

10. 마이크로서비스의 더 많은 활용:

마이크로 서비스 애플리케이션을 구조화하는 데 사용되는 유명한 방법입니다. 마이크로서비스를 통해 기업은 애플리케이션을 더 작고 관리하기 쉬운 부분으로 나눌 수 있습니다. 2022년에는 기업이 마이크로서비스를 사용하여 생산 효율성을 높이는 것을 목격하게 될 것입니다.

마이크로서비스를 사용하면 다음과 같은 이점이 있습니다.

  • 마이크로서비스를 사용하면 소프트웨어 제품을 개발하고 배포하는 동안 효율성이 향상됩니다.
  • 이를 통해 애플리케이션을 더 작은 부분으로 나누고 관리하기 쉽게 만듭니다.
  • 애플리케이션의 다양한 부분의 통신 프로세스를 향상시킵니다.

11. QR 코드 생성기

QR코드는 산업 전반에 걸쳐 다양한 목적으로 널리 사용되고 있습니다. 가장 일반적인 용도는 결제 서비스임에도 불구하고 실용적인 마케팅 도구로 인기를 얻고 있습니다. 요즘에는 TV 광고, 광고판 및 비장, 소셜 미디어 게시물, 레스토랑 메뉴 카드 및 기타 다양한 형태에서 QR 코드를 볼 수 있습니다. 모든 최고의 QR 코드 생성기를 사용하면 다른 QR 코드와 차별화되도록 QR 코드를 맞춤 설정할 수 있습니다.

평판이 좋은 일부 혜택 QR 코드 생성기 제공되는 것은 다음과 같습니다:

  • 브랜드 로고가 포함된 맞춤형 QR 코드
  • 다중 채널 공유 기능
  • 추적 및 분석

올해 소프트웨어 개발자의 관심이 필요한 것은 이러한 XNUMX가지 트렌드만이 아닙니다. 끊임없이 진화하는 디지털화 시대에 정기적으로 동향을 주시하는 것이 중요합니다. 내일의 소프트웨어 개발 동향이 무엇을 가져올지 누가 알겠습니까?

소프트웨어 부문에서는 올해 최고의 소프트웨어 개발 동향을 볼 수 있을 것입니다. 기업은 성공을 위한 경쟁에 계속 머물기 위해 이러한 추세를 따라야 합니다.

최신 상태를 유지하면 시장 수요를 파악하고 새로운 소프트웨어 개발 동향이 나타날 때마다 업데이트를 제공하는 데 도움이 됩니다. 이러한 소프트웨어 개발 추세는 더 좋고, 더 빠르고, 더 효율적인 제품을 만들 것입니다.